Giants Conduct In-Person Interview with John Harbaugh
The New York Giants’ search for their next head coach took a significant step forward this week, as the team hosted a major candidate for an extensive, in-person meeting. According to a person familiar with the situation, Baltimore Ravens head coach John Harbaugh interviewed with the Giants at their team facility in East Rutherford, New Jersey.
The source, who spoke to The Associated Press on condition of anonymity because the details of the search are private, indicated that Harbaugh was at the Giants’ headquarters for most of the day on Wednesday. This move signals serious mutual interest between the veteran coach and the storied franchise.
A Proven Leader Enters the Conversation
John Harbaugh is one of the most respected and successful head coaches in the NFL. Since taking over the Baltimore Ravens in 2008, he has compiled a impressive record, leading the team to a Super Bowl XLVII victory and maintaining a culture of consistent competitiveness. His potential availability immediately made him one of the most coveted names in this coaching cycle.
An in-person interview is a key phase in any high-profile NFL hiring process. It allows team ownership and management, including Giants co-owners John Mara and Steve Tisch, to engage in deeper conversations about philosophy, vision, and roster construction. For Harbaugh, it’s an opportunity to assess the organization’s commitment and resources firsthand.
